Ohio DJFS Employment Verification Form Guide

This documentation confirms an individual’s employment history with a specific Ohio employer. It typically includes details such as dates of employment, job title, and salary information. Often, third parties like lenders, landlords, or other government agencies request this documentation to verify an individual’s financial stability or eligibility for services. For example, a mortgage lender might require it to assess an applicant’s ability to repay a loan.

Accurate and readily available employment records are crucial for both employees and employers. For individuals, these records serve as proof of income and work history, essential for securing loans, housing, and other necessities. Businesses benefit from streamlined processes for responding to verification requests, minimizing disruptions to their operations while maintaining compliance with regulations. Historically, obtaining this type of documentation could be a time-consuming process involving manual record checks. Modern systems aim to improve efficiency and security.

9+ Top Family Law Employment Opportunities & Jobs

Positions within this legal field encompass a range of roles, such as legal assistants, paralegals, mediators, and attorneys specializing in areas like divorce, child custody, adoption, and domestic violence. For instance, a paralegal might assist an attorney with case preparation, client communication, and legal research focusing on relevant statutes and case law. A mediator, on the other hand, would facilitate negotiations between disputing parties to reach mutually agreeable solutions outside of court.

These career paths offer individuals the chance to contribute meaningfully to resolving sensitive family matters, advocating for vulnerable individuals, and promoting the well-being of families. Historically, this practice area has evolved significantly, with increasing specialization and a growing emphasis on alternative dispute resolution methods. This evolution reflects societal changes and the increasing complexity of family structures and related legal issues.

6+ Family Preservation Services Jobs & Careers

Opportunities within this field involve supporting families facing challenges that may lead to child removal. Professionals in these roles provide in-home interventions, resources, and skill-building to strengthen families and create safer environments for children. For instance, a caseworker might help parents develop budgeting strategies, connect them with substance abuse treatment, or teach positive parenting techniques.

Strengthening families through such support offers significant benefits, including preventing the trauma of family separation, promoting child well-being, and reducing long-term costs associated with foster care. Historically, child welfare systems often focused on removing children from challenging home environments. The shift towards preserving families recognizes the importance of maintaining family bonds whenever safely possible and providing support to address underlying issues. This approach emphasizes building on existing family strengths to create lasting positive change.
